Onboarding: Pairline matching service — GC pauses. The Pairline matcher runs on a generational collector, and full pauses above 400ms can stall order matching long enough to trigger our failover. For your review: pause telemetry is signed and retained for 90 days, and the failover path requires unsealing the standby's credential store. To perform that unseal during an audit drill, use the recovery passphrase below.

vault phrase of bagap-yajof = fenath-druwyn

## Partner SFTP drop: files not appearing

When Bramleigh Logistics files stop landing in the intake bucket, first confirm the Ostermill relay service is running and that the drop folder quota hasn't been exceeded. Stale lock files in /incoming/locks are the usual culprit; clear any older than an hour. To replay missed transfers via the relay API, authenticate with the token below.

session JWT of yawep-yawep = eyJhbGciOiJIUzI1NiIsInR5cCI6IkpXVCJ9.eyJzdWIiOiI3pWF3_In0.aXYsHiog

Cleaning crews from Brightmarsh Services attend the Kellowan House lobby each weekday evening between 18:30 and 21:00. Reception must verify each crew member against the rota supplied by the facilities coordinator, issue a temporary lanyard, and record arrival and departure times in the visitor ledger. Crew members may not access the third-floor archive or the server corridor under any circumstances. To admit the crew through the service door, use the access code shown below.

staff pass of kawip-hawef = bdg-QLP-2

Subject: Firmware channel cut-over complete

Team,

The cut-over from the legacy Lanternbox update channel to the new Driftline channel finished last night. All shipping devices now poll Driftline; the old endpoint returns a permanent redirect until end of quarter. Support should expect a brief spike in "update pending" tickets while devices re-register. For troubleshooting, the channel settings devices should report in diagnostics are the following.

service settings:
WENATH_PIN=5007
WENATH_METRICS_HOST=metrics.wenath.tolvaqlabs.corp
WENATH_LOG_LEVEL=debug
WENATH_TENANT=rusox